Our friends at Core77 threw the hungry blogging pirhanas a tasty bite from Dalex Designs today — a little tool called a “toothbork” that is both a fork and a toothbrush. But I must say, I was in their camp, finding greater inspiration from Dalex’s Paisley Bench, the minimalist piece of furniture with secret embellishments on its underside.
